5TH ANNUAL REEF SWEETWATER PRO AM SURF CONTEST WRAP UP

July 16, 2009 by val

The 5th Annual Reef Sweetwater Pro Am Surf contest was jam packed the entire weekend July 10-12th at Wrightsville Beach, NC. It is one of the largest east coast surf competitions that attracts thousands to the beach each year. Spy’s local Ben Bourgeois and Mike Losness ended up with a commendable semi-final finish.
